City Guide
Bramstedt, Lower Saxony, Germany
Overview
Bramstedt is a quaint village in Lower Saxony, Germany, known for its rustic charm, abundant nature, and close-knit community. It offers a peaceful rural atmosphere, perfect for visitors seeking relaxation and authentic German village life. The town is surrounded by moorland and scenic countryside, making it ideal for outdoor activities.
Best Time to Visit
May-September for pleasant weather, outdoor activities, and local events.
Local Tips
Public transport is limited, renting a car or using bicycles is recommended. Most shops close early and are not open on Sundays; plan ahead for groceries.
Cultural Etiquette
Tipping is appreciated (5-10%), casual dress is fine but neatness is respected, greet locals with a friendly 'Hallo.'
Safety Warnings
Bramstedt is very safe; just be mindful of traffic on rural roads and watch for cyclists and farm vehicles.
Hidden Gems
Explore the moorland nature reserves for bird-watching, visit farm shops for local produce, and discover picturesque cycling routes around Ellinghausen.
